Baseball Recap: Arlington Eagles vs. Fort Calhoun Pioneers
Arlington had lost four straight at home, but on Tuesday they dropped their record down to 5-9 to make it five. They lost 11-0 to the Fort Calhoun Pioneers.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Pioneers this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 3-0 on April 3rd.
Arlington sa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Tanner Kyllo, who went 1-for-2 with one double.
As for Fort Calhoun, they have been performing well recently as they've won three of their last four games. That's provided a nice bump to their 11-4 record this season. Those vict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 3.5 runs on average over those games.
On Fort Calhoun's side, not much got past Kenny Wellwood, who gave up just four hits to keep Arlington off the board. Wellwood has been consistent: he hasn't given up more than one earned run in five consecutive appearances.
At the plate, the team relied heavily on Chase Bierman, who went 3-for-4 with four RBI, two runs, and one double. That's the most hits he has posted since back in March. Another player making a difference was Chase Premer, who got on base in three of his four plate appearances with two RBI and one double.
We've got plenty of inter-district action coming up soon. Arlington will face off against rival Malcolm at 4:30 p.m. on Friday. Meanwhile, Fort Calhoun is set to square off against their familiar foe Raymond Central at 4:30 p.m. on Thursday.
